Job Description



  • Oversee day-to-day management of shell construction projects, from pre-construction through to structure completion


  • Coordinate schedules, subcontractors, and material deliveries to ensure timely execution


  • Serve as the primary liaison between field teams, GCs, and ownership


  • Monitor budgets, identify cost-saving opportunities, and manage project documentation


  • Ensure safety protocols and quality standards are upheld throughout the project lifecycle

The Successful Applicant



  • 3+ years of experience as a Project Manager or Assistant PM within a shell contractor


  • Proven background managing structural concrete scopes on high-rise multifamily or mixed-use projects


  • Strong knowledge of construction documents, CPM scheduling, and field coordination


  • Bilingual in English and Spanish preferred but not required


  • Highly organized, detail-oriented, and driven to see projects through to successful completion
